Central Maine Healthcare is an integrated healthcare delivery system serving 400,000 people living in central, western and Midcoast Maine. CMH's hospital facilities include Central Maine Medical Center in Lewiston, Bridgton Hospital and Rumford Hospital. CMH also supports Central Maine Medical Group, a primary and specialty care practice organization. Other system services include the Central Maine Heart and Vascular Institute, a regional trauma program, LifeFlight of Maine's southern Maine base, the Central Maine Comprehensive Cancer Center and other high-quality clinical services.

Essential Duties


• Performs a thorough, organized and objective physical therapy evaluation in appropriate enough depth for patient diagnosis and clinical presentation; identifies the physical therapy problems from the evaluation and incorporates patient potential as well as major barriers to treatment.
• Develops appropriate treatment goal/plan that is based on the evaluation findings, the patient’s goals, review of the medical record, a history, the referring physician’s goal for the patient, and information gathered from the patient’s health care team.
• Demonstrates a timely progression in the plan and an update of the plan/goals based on the patient’s response to intervention and reassessments per dept. policies. Demonstrates timely/correct equipment selection and appliance selection and provides guidance/instruction to the patient.
• Demonstrates individualized appropriate treatment planning including appropriate therapy application and treatment intervention including but not limited to the areas of gait, balance, cardiopulmonary reconditioning, neuromuscular re-education, orthotic/prosthetic application and training, manual therapy skills, joint protection instruction, ergonomics and body mechanics, assistive and adaptive devices, neuromotor development, wound management, sensory integration, and patient/family education.
• When the Physical Therapist delegates treatment of a patient to the Physical Therapy Assistant, they must provide supervision of treatment to assure that the treatment plan remains appropriate.
• Discusses and advises medical staff, patients and patient families, support staff and affiliating students regarding indications/contraindications for treatment, offers alternative modes of treatment and advises in the proper utilization of the service as supported by current physical therapy literature/research.
• Delivers treatment in compliance with departmental policies, protocols, and per the American Physical Therapy Associations’ code of Ethics and Standards of Practice.
• Modifies treatment session based on accurate interpretation of patient’s response to treatment.
• Demonstrates ability to assess patient pain interfering with optimal level of function or participation in rehabilitation - makes appropriate physician contact for intervention.
• Addresses in treatment sessions, patient’s identified Physical Therapy goals, per the evaluation.
• Performs all aspects of patient care in an environment that optimizes patient safety and reduces the likelihood of medical/health care errors.
• Interacts professionally with patient/family and involves patient/family in the formation of the plan of care and conducts treatment sessions to assure the safety of the therapist, support staff and the patient at all times.
• Treats patients and their families with respect and dignity. Identifies and addresses psychosocial, cultural, ethnic and religious/spiritual needs of patients and their families.
